Author bio
Alex Villavasso grew up in New Orleans, Louisiana, and his public bios keep coming back to the same early picture: a kid in Louisiana, reading fiction through the summer and getting pulled deeper into invented worlds. That start makes sense once you look at the books. Even his earliest work goes straight for big hooks, strange powers, monsters, revenge, and young heroes under pressure.
He came to writing through genre fiction first.
Villavasso began publishing in the mid 2010s, and among his early books were The Dreamer and the Deceiver and Sailor Ray and the Darkest Night. One is epic fantasy with superhuman gifts and a tyrannical king. The other is urban fantasy about a demon hunter whose second chance at life comes at a brutal cost. Different settings, same instinct: take a character, hurt them early, then make them fight their way through the fallout.
That taste for momentum shows up all through The Last Light, the Pact books, and later series like Blaze Monroe and the Broken Heart. Villavasso likes fast plots, direct first person voices, and action that lands cleanly on the page. His stories usually move with purpose. There is often a hunt, a mission, or an attack already in motion by chapter one.
He keeps the worlds moving.
Then came his superhero side. In The Loner and The Prodigy, he shifts into a school setting, but not a cozy one. Aiden Cross lands at Crown Academy and finds bullying, unstable powers, hidden agendas, and the uncomfortable fact that being special does not make life easier. Readers who enjoy supernatural academy stories tend to find a lot to like here, especially the mix of teen frustration, training, and rising stakes.
Villavasso also keeps circling a few favorite ideas. Power almost always has a price. Hidden gifts can feel a lot like curses. Friends, siblings, and hunting partners matter because his protagonists are often isolated at the start. Even when the backdrop is epic, the core conflict is usually personal: grief, revenge, loyalty, fear, or the question of what someone is becoming while they chase strength.
You can see that clearly in his newer work, too. The Legend Of Dark Heart 1, released on April 10, 2026, moves into LitRPG territory but keeps the same DNA. Nolan Crest wants power badly, gets it in a dangerous form, and has to live with what that power is doing to him. It is a new subgenre step, but it still feels like a Villavasso setup.
His books range across fantasy, paranormal fiction, science fiction, urban fantasy, and superhero fantasy, but they are linked by mood and pace more than shelf label.
Villavasso keeps his public profile fairly light. Short author notes say he was born in New Orleans and raised in Louisiana, and that when he is not trying to get ideas out of his head, he is happy doing normal things like sleeping, catching up with friends, and spending too much time on Netflix. He has also continued adding new books and series over the years, which fits the restless, always-in-motion feel of the work itself.
